About The Position

Reyes Fleet Management is hiring immediately at our Reyes Coca Cola Bottling facility in Alsip, IL. Seeking a Fleet Diesel Mechanic A to help with repairs and maintenance on trailer/tractor equipment. Shift: Full-Time l 2nd Shift 2:00PM-10:30PM Monday - FridayPay: $36.68/HR CDL Incentive Pay (Additional $1.00/per hour with active CDL A license)-Preferred but not required Perks and Benefits: Incentive pay Eligibility 0.25 per T Series ASE certification -Maximum $2.00 per hour Paid Time off and holiday pay Career advancement opportunities after 6 months of employment Health, dental, and vision coverage Reyes Rewards and referral bonuses Union Benefits Position Responsibilities: The Fleet Technician is responsible for the repair, maintenance, and overhaul of fleet diesel equipment, as well as the diagnostics and rebuilding of clutches and brake systems As a Fleet Technician, you will complete thorough documentation for work orders related to repairs and preventative maintenance using the online AssetWorks system You will operate a company vehicle to diagnose and repair equipment as part of roadside service calls You will ensure that equipment has the required licensing and registration before being deemed "roadworthy" You will install, replace, and repair onboard computers (XRS or XataNet) and/or cameras (DriveCam) You will work in accordance with company, local, state, and federal policies and regulations to ensure safety Other duties as assigned Essential Information for Our Employees At the Reyes Family of Businesses, our Total Rewards Strategy prioritizes the holistic well-being of our employees, and our compensation philosophy embraces diverse factors for fair pay decisions, valuing skills, experience, and the needs of our business. Requirements

  • High School Diploma or General Education Degree (GED) and 3 plus years of related experience
  • Ability to lift 50 pounds, occasionally lift 100 pounds
  • Must possess own tools (have minimum tool requirement)
  • Valid driver's license and acceptable motor vehicle record in compliance with Department of Transportation regulations to operate applicable company vehicles
